Ralph D. Hoffman

July 26, 2004

    Ralph D. Hoffman, 86, a lifelong resident of Scranton, died Monday morning at home after a brief illness. His wife is the former Eleanor Milberger. They would have celebrated their 60th wedding anniversary Dec. 5.

    Born in Dunmore, son of the late Anthony and Mary McLaughlin Hoffman, he was a member of the Hickory Street Presbyterian Church. An Army veteran of World War II, he served in the European theater with the 1268th Combat Engineers. He was a member of the American Legion Maj. Edward J. Poch Post 948, South Scranton, and the National Rifle Association, and enjoyed fishing. Prior to retirement, he was employed as a building superintendent for JC Penney.

    Also surviving are a son, Ralph D. Jr., Scranton; a daughter, Linda C. and husband Lewis Lorinsky, Stonington, Conn.; a granddaughter, Jaclyn Lorinsky, Stonington, Conn.; and several nieces and nephews.

    He was preceded in death by two sisters, Mabel and Geraldine Hoffman, and four brothers, Harry, Robert, Ellwood and George.
